A/R: Chief Justice Inaugurates Justice Clubs in 10 Senior High Schools

The Chief Justice, His Lordship Justice Paul Baffoe-Bonnie, has inaugurated and sworn in elected officers of Justice Clubs from ten selected Senior High Schools in the Ashanti Region.
This is part of efforts by the Judicial Service to extend its civic education initiative to more parts of the country.
The ceremony, held in Kumasi, brought together students and staff from Afia Kobi Ampem Girls Senior High School, Anglican Senior High School, Dwamena Akenten Senior High School, Effiduase Senior High School, Juaben Senior High School, Konongo Odumase Senior High School, Opoku Ware School, Prempeh College, St. Monica’s Senior High School and Yaa Asantewaa Girls Senior High School.
The Justice Clubs initiative, which already operates in the Greater Accra, Western, Central and Eastern Regions, is designed to expose young people to the principles of law, justice and ethical leadership.
Delivering his address, Chief Justice Baffoe-Bonnie said the Judiciary remains committed to nurturing the next generation of leaders with “the knowledge and understanding of the language of the law and the spirit that gives it life.”
He urged the newly sworn-in officers to lead by example and serve as worthy ambassadors of justice in their schools and communities.
The Chairperson of the Chief Justice’s Mentoring Programme, Her Ladyship Justice Olivia Anku-Tsede [JA], noted that membership of the clubs is open to all students regardless of their intended career path.
“The Clubs provide a unique platform for young people to develop critical thinking, analytical reasoning, ethical leadership and effective communication, with a deep appreciation for justice. These are values and skills that are indispensable in every profession and in every sphere of life,” she said.
The Judicial Service of Ghana said it intends to roll out the programme next in the Northern Region as part of efforts to deepen public understanding of the rule of law among young Ghanaians.
